how expensive were these lights? i started out with some of those cheap ebay lights but i want to upgrade to some good lights. also how does ur battery do while you are plowing while using the strobes, winch, and back light?
chvyzilla454 2 years ago
They cost about $450..The battery doesnt do too bad...the winch and the headlights together dont go good,m but the leds and winch do great. the intesnity of the leds is minimized when the winch is in use, but you cant really notice. They are still bright when the power is being used by the winch, just not as bright. I also have the crappy ebay ones, but i wouldnt dare put them on my atv...i dont have any strobes..i only have leds so that keeps the power down on the battery which is good.
